§ 3-7-38.2-15 — Cancellation of registration

Text
At the expiration of the period ending thirty
(30)days after the second general election following the date on which
notices are mailed to a voter described in section 14(2) of this chapter,
the county voter registration office shall cancel the registration of a
voter who has not responded to the notice sent under section 13 of this
chapter.

Legislative History
As added by P.L.3-1997, SEC.104. Amended by P.L.38-1999,
SEC.17.
